Common Name2-Methyl-6-(methylthio)pyrazine
ClassSmall Molecule
Description2-Methyl-6-(methylthio)pyrazine is a flavouring ingredient with roasted almond-hazelnut aroma. 2-Methyl-6-(methylthio)pyrazine is a component of FEMA 3208, together with regioisomers.

Chemical Taxonomy
Description belongs to the class of organic compounds known as aryl thioethers. These are organosulfur compounds containing a thioether group that is substituted by an aryl group.
